Academic Coordination Commitee

The Academic Coordination Committee advises the Head of Centre on academic issues. The Academic Coordination Committee is comprised of representatives of all four faculties (HUMANITIES, LAW, SOCIAL SCIENCES and THEOLOGY) and acts as assessment and funding committee in connection with Queen Mary’s Centre's annual distribution of start and instant funding.
